Doric columns surrounded cryselephantine statue in east area of the cella. Shafts of columns have slight convex curves, get a little smaller going up. Deviations serve to imbue building with pulse of life. All surfaces that could have sculpture did. Chryselephantine statue stood at height of 13 m. Understanding design of parthenon in terms of older temples. Parthenon is unique in terms of putting together orders, sculpture and overall configuration. Configuration seen before at early archaic temple temple of artemis at corfu, 580 bc. Parthenon was largest doric temple of greek mainland when it was constructed. Greater amount of columns allowed temple to look soaring and ethereal. Configuration of interior building, within 8x17 peristyle there is two rooms plus unusual entranceways. Prostyle arrangement is more commonly seen in ionic temples - similar to temple of athena nike. Find first integration at temple of athena at paestum (500. Bc) which had doric exterior colonnade and pro-style ionic porch.
